  1. Hey, Ran into this issue as well because I deleted the repo while having a bunch of files locked out. I managed to automate the unlocking process for hundreds of files with a batch script. 

    First use "cm listlocks > out.txt" to save the output to a txt file. Open the txt file (I was using Rider to do this) and delete everything except for the hashes. on each line add cm lock unlock at the start of the line (so you end up with something like this:

    cm lock unlock 7525e94c-2722-41b9-953f-a4011cffc932
    cm lock unlock aa8e7596-0a5c-4242-b743-279dac99ab9e
    cm lock unlock c60a72a1-80dc-4522-bf15-6fa40a0aeda7
    cm lock unlock 4577883f-c479-4359-988e-82ca40fcf798
    cm lock unlock f20db7f1-01cf-4dc9-8e9c-30ea944d2a2b

    Save that file as "unlock.bat" or whatever name with the .bat extension. Open a cmd in the repo directory and press tab until you get the .bat file you just made, hit enter and watch it unlock all your files (albeit very slowly, it will do it automatically). 

    Hope that helps anyone out there in lock hell!
